endor.activateStartButton = function(){
    if($('login-button')){
        var cloud1 = $('cloud1');
        var cloud2 = $('cloud2');
        var cloud3 = $('cloud3');
        var cloud4 = $('cloud4');
        var loginPos = $('login-button').getPosition().x - 50;
        var registerPos = $('register-button').getPosition().x - 50;
        var createPos = $$('.create-current')[0].getPosition().x - 50;
        var campaignsPos = $$('.campaigns-current')[0].getPosition().x - 50;




        var cloudFxHide4 = new Fx.Morph(cloud4, {duration: 'normal', transition: Fx.Transitions.Sine.easeOut});
        var cloudFxFly4 = new Fx.Morph(cloud4, {duration: 1500, transition: Fx.Transitions.Sine.easeOut, onComplete:function(){
            cloudFxHide4.start({
                'opacity': [1, 0]
            });
        }});
        var cloudFxShow4 = new Fx.Morph(cloud4, {duration: 'normal', transition: Fx.Transitions.Sine.easeOut, onComplete:function(){
            cloudFxFly4.start({
                'top': [-50],
                'left':[campaignsPos]
            });
        }});
        var cloudFxHide3 = new Fx.Morph(cloud3, {duration: 'normal', transition: Fx.Transitions.Sine.easeOut});
        var cloudFxFly3 = new Fx.Morph(cloud3, {duration: 1500, transition: Fx.Transitions.Sine.easeOut, onComplete:function(){
            cloudFxHide3.start({
                'opacity': [1, 0]
            });
            cloudFxShow4.start({
                'opacity': [0, 1],
                'height': [0, '123px']
            });
        }});
        var cloudFxShow3 = new Fx.Morph(cloud3, {duration: 'normal', transition: Fx.Transitions.Sine.easeOut, onComplete:function(){
            cloudFxFly3.start({
                'top': [-50],
                'left':[createPos]
            });
        }});
        var cloudFxHide2 = new Fx.Morph(cloud2, {duration: 'normal', transition: Fx.Transitions.Sine.easeOut});
        var cloudFxFly2 = new Fx.Morph(cloud2, {duration: 1500, transition: Fx.Transitions.Sine.easeOut, onComplete:function(){
            cloudFxHide2.start({
                'opacity': [1, 0]
            });
            cloudFxShow3.start({
                'opacity': [0, 1],
                'height': [0, '123px']
            });
        }});
        var cloudFxShow2 = new Fx.Morph(cloud2, {duration: 'normal', transition: Fx.Transitions.Sine.easeOut, onComplete:function(){
            cloudFxFly2.start({
                'top': [-50],
                'left':[registerPos]
            });
        }});
        var cloudFxHide1 = new Fx.Morph(cloud1, {duration: 'normal', transition: Fx.Transitions.Sine.easeOut});
        var cloudFxFly1 = new Fx.Morph(cloud1, {duration: 1500, transition: Fx.Transitions.Sine.easeOut, onComplete:function(){
            cloudFxHide1.start({
                'opacity': [1, 0]
            });
            cloudFxShow2.start({
                'opacity': [0, 1],
                'height': [0, '123px']
            });
        }});
        var cloudFxShow1 = new Fx.Morph(cloud1, {duration: 'normal', transition: Fx.Transitions.Sine.easeOut, onComplete:function(){
            cloudFxFly1.start({
                'top': [-50],
                'left':[loginPos]
            });
        }});
        endor.startbutton.addEvent('click', function(event){
            //location.href = '/showCampaignForm'
            cloud1.getFirst().set('html', i18n('container.cloud.1'));
            cloud1.position({x:endor.startbutton.getPosition().x, y:endor.startbutton.getPosition().y-5});
            cloud2.getFirst().set('html', '... '+i18n('container.cloud.2'));
            cloud2.position({x:endor.startbutton.getPosition().x, y:endor.startbutton.getPosition().y-5});
            cloud3.getFirst().set('html', i18n('container.cloud.3'));
            cloud3.position({x:endor.startbutton.getPosition().x, y:endor.startbutton.getPosition().y-5});
            cloud4.getFirst().set('html', i18n('container.cloud.4'));
            cloud4.position({x:endor.startbutton.getPosition().x, y:endor.startbutton.getPosition().y-5});
            cloudFxShow1.start({
                'opacity': [0, 1],
                'height': [0, '123px']
            });

        });
    }
    else{
        endor.startbutton.addEvent('click', function(event){
            location.href = '/showCampaignForm'
        });
    }

};



window.addEvent('domready', function() {
    endor.startbutton = $('button-get-started');
    endor.activateStartButton();
});